OK I keep seeing comments on Moolah having held the title for nearly 30 years and I want to set the record straight. She did NOT hold it the entire time. She won a tournament in the fall of 1956 to become the first NWA Women's champion. 1966 she lost it to Betty Boucher. She won it back within a month. Spring 1968 she loses it to Yukiko Tomoe. Wins it back about one month later. Winter 1976 loses it to Sue Green. Gains it back a month later. Fall 1978 she loses it to Evelyn Stevens.
